智华数控钻的编程主要涉及G代码和M代码的使用,具体编程步骤如下:
了解工件要求
首先需要了解工件的形状、尺寸和加工要求,以确定加工路径和工具选择。
设计加工路径
根据工件要求,设计出合适的加工路径,包括进给路径、刀具路径等。
编写G代码
根据设计的加工路径,编写相应的G代码,完成数控钻床的运动控制。G代码是控制数控钻床运动和加工路径的主要编程方式,以字母"G"开头,后面跟着一个或多个数字值,每个数字值代表一种运动或操作,例如移动到指定位置、设定进给速度、选择工具等。
编写M代码
根据工序需要,编写相应的M代码,控制数控钻床的辅助功能。M代码是以字母"M"开头,后面跟着一个或多个数字值,每个数字值代表一种辅助功能的操作,例如开启冷却系统、切换刀具等。
调试和优化
编写完成后,需要进行调试和优化,确保编程结果符合预期。
示例编程步骤
确定钻孔起点和终点的坐标位置
可以通过数控钻床的坐标系进行定位,或者使用外部测量工具确定。
编写G代码
在编程软件中,使用文本编辑器或者特定的G代码编辑器编写代码。以下是一个简单的G代码程序示例:
```
N1 G00 X10 Y10 ; 将钻头快速移动到起始位置
N2 G83 Z-10 R2 F100 ; 在Z轴上进行钻孔,每次进给2mm,进给速度为100mm/min
N3 G00 Z10 ; 钻孔完成后将钻头抬起
```
设置数控钻床的参数和工件夹持方式,确认无误后启动钻孔程序。
注意事项
在编程过程中,需要考虑刀具的进给方式,如快速定位、切削进给等。
对于深孔钻孔,可以使用G83指令,并设置相应的参数,如初始点增量(R)、每次钻深(Q)、孔底留时间(P)、进给量(F)和重复次数(K)。
通过以上步骤和注意事项,可以实现智华数控钻的精确和高效加工。建议编程前仔细检查工件要求和加工路径,确保编程的准确性和可靠性。